About the game

What you do in a play session

Cards Against Humanity: The Bigger, Blacker Box is the ultimate expansion box for fans of the iconic dark‑humor party game. Measuring 21 inches long, weighing 17 ounces and finished in sleek black, it acts as a sturdy vault for the base deck and every expansion released so far. Inside you’ll find the 20‑card "Box" expansion (yes, all about boxes), 50 blank cards (40 white, 10 black) for custom jokes, plus foam filler and divider cards to keep everything tidy. The kicker? The box can double as a makeshift bludgeon at wild parties! Like the original, the game’s core mechanic is simple: each round a black card presents a fill‑in‑the‑blank prompt, and players simultaneously select a white card from their hand that they think is the funniest or most shocking. Hand management matters when you decide which cards to keep for later rounds. The pace is fast, the laughs are loud, and the mature content adds an extra edge. Designed for 4‑30 players, a typical game lasts about 30 minutes, making it perfect for casual gatherings, birthday parties, or game nights. Just remember the humor can be offensive to some, so choose your audience wisely. In short, the Bigger, Blacker Box gives you more space, more cards, and more chances to spark hilarity (or awkward moments) in one solid black case.

Frequently Asked Questions

Quick answers before you buy

7 questions
How many players can join?
From 4 up to 30 players, perfect for big parties.
How long does a game last?
Typically about 30 minutes, depending on group size.
Do I need the base game to use this box?
Yes, the box is only storage and expansion; the base deck is required.
What components are included?
20 "Box" expansion cards, 50 blank cards (40 white, 10 black), foam filler, divider cards, and the black storage box.
Is it suitable for all ages?
No. The content is adult‑oriented and may contain offensive language and themes.
Can I create my own cards?
Absolutely, the 50 blank cards let you write your own jokes.
